Smart Mapping

Many robot vacuums do not have mapping capabilities. This can be a problem when you try to get your home clean. These budget-friendly vacuums may be stuck on a broad variety of obstacles, including cords, furniture legs, and pet toys that have popped up from the cushions of your sofa.

The most effective robot vacuums that avoid obstacles utilize multiple cameras and sensors in order to create a precise room map as they move around your home. This lets them navigate your rooms more efficiently by organizing their cleaning in a planned order and not looking at areas that they have already cleaned. This also helps them avoid getting stuck on items that have been moved during a cleaning process or needing to spend more time "robot-proofing" your home by putting cords away.

Robot vacuums employ a variety of methods of navigation to create maps which range from the most basic to the most modern. Self-Emptying Dustbins

One of the most attractive characteristics of robot vacuum cleaner amazon vacuum ebay (More about the author) vacuums is their ability to transfer debris automatically from their onboard dustbins to their docking bases, without any user intervention. This means that you don't have to constantly bend down to empty the bin and, in turn, reduces the frequency of maintenance tasks. This is particularly important if your home is large and you want to cut down on the amount of time your hands are occupied with dirt and dust.

Check if the robot has bags to collect debris, or if it does not. A bagged model can help you avoid releasing dust clumps into the atmosphere when it's emptied, but you'll need to purchase and replace the bags frequently. If a model that is bagless is what you prefer, search for models with a smart sensor that monitors the onboard dustbin for fullness and notify you when it's time to be cleaned.

Remote Control

Robotic vacuum cleaners can be operated remotely and can be controlled via apps, voice commands, or traditional remotes. They also come with automated self-charging functions and scheduling features, which makes it simple to maintain the cleanliness of your home without manual involvement. If you opt for an option that is smart-compatible it will be able to connect to your Wi-Fi network and communicate with your smartphone. This lets you control the device using an app, schedule cleaning sessions, and check your battery status and mapping history. If your robovac has a camera it can also be used with the app to review photographs of your surroundings. This is useful for identifying objects that the robot might have missed during its previous cleaning routine for example, pets toys or chewed-up socks.

Most of the best robots have this type of smart integration. Certain robots are compatible with Google Assistant. This means that you can activate them simply by giving a command via a smart speaker. Some devices may have trouble communicating with Google Assistant due to signal strength or proximity. Keeping the device updated and reducing the distance between it and your Wi-Fi router, or even thinking about an extender that connects to Wi-Fi could solve this issue.
